Short-Term Home Care Insurance is designed to help pay for home health services for a limited benefit period — typically up to 12 months.
These plans can help cover:
In-home nursing care
Home health aide services
Assistance with daily activities (bathing, dressing, meals)
Therapy services at home
Recovery care following surgery or hospitalization
This type of coverage is often easier to qualify for and more affordable than traditional long-term care insurance.

While plans vary by carrier, most short-term home care policies include:
A daily or weekly benefit amount
A benefit period (often up to 360 days)
A short elimination period before benefits begin
Simplified underwriting
Benefits are typically paid directly to you or the provider, depending on the policy structure.

Considerations
Short-Term Home Care Insurance:
Is not traditional long-term care insurance
Does not typically provide lifetime benefits
May have health underwriting requirements
May not cover pre-existing conditions
Has specific policy definitions for eligibility
